Reviews: Paris Pass Plus: Tickets to Louvre, Eiffel Tower & 90+ more
Guest User2026-01-01
I used this product as I couldn’t pay by my card on official site. Real Go City Pass Plus that includes Paris museum pass. I bought for 4 days for two people (650 euro 🌚). I am not sure if it was worth all money but we used it to eat 6 times; plus additionally cheese tasting (very enough to taste) and wine tasting (only three glasses but still good). But this meals should be planned as there are particular hours for pass usage. We used it to go d’Orsay museum without line and also for Opera self-guide visit. Very good experience! I couldn’t use it for all wanted museums as there are no tickets with time slots. If we could book that tickets (Louvre, Versailles) we would spend this pass more. I suppose if you buy this pass in advance for chosen dates and book free tickets (that is assumed for this pass) in advance when your pass is supposed to be activate then go city pass is much more money worth.
